Are you a Maintenance Electrician? Have you previously worked in a heavy forge environment? Do you want to work for one of the UKs leading independent aerospace and industrial forgers? Independent Forgings and Alloys (IFA) have an exciting opportunity to join their Maintenance team as a Maintenance Electrician The role is working Monday to Friday on working on rotating 2 shift pattern Monday to Friday - 6am-1.30pm and 12-7.30pm. Main duties of the role: Planned Preventative Maintenance tasks Installation of new plant Planning electrical maintenance tasks for completion during the shutdown Development and upgrading of existing equipment Good knowledge of safety and permit to work systems Reactive Maintenance PAT testing Inspection and testing of electrical equipment You Should be: Apprentice trained maintenance engineer with electrical bias Previous experience in heavy industrial environment NVQ Level 3 in electrical engineering or equivalent 17th Edition wiring regulations Have experience in fault finding, wiring and instrumentation work, preventative maintenance (PPM) reactive maintenance Fault finding on PLC More about IFA: We manufacture high-integrity, open-die and closed-die forged components in nickel alloy, titanium, stai...
